I know that feeling, I have it too sometimes. I know I have to do something for school, but I can't get any motivation and just wander on the internet, which makes me only feel more bad about myself.

 

It is mostly because you have the feeling that you are not capable of doing what you want, in this case getting good enough grades. You have to try to change this feeling, so to get more confidence in your own abilities. When your confidence is up, it's much easier to concentrate on your study and you will feel better about yourself overall.

 

What I think to do best is to think about things concerning your study that went well or other things that make you proud of yourself. Think mostly of good things. If you would think of something that brings you down, try to analyze that situation in a way that you end up with thinking that that didn't matter so much.You said that helping people motivates you, I have that too. By helping someone and getting their thanks, I get the feeling that I was of importance to that person, which makes me happy about myself. Talking to others about it (what you're actually doing now) is also good, since you can get advice and you get to know that you are by far not the only one that has this problem. You're really not the only one. Others can also make you feel better about yourself by telling you things they like about you or things that they think you should be proud of.

 

What also may help as an extra is special music that helps you to concentrate, you can find enough on YouTube.
